VBsupport перешел с домена .ORG на родной .RU
Ура!
Пожалуйста, обновите свои закладки - VBsupport.ru
Блок РКН снят, форум доступен на всей территории России, включая новые терртории, без VPN
На форуме введена премодерация ВСЕХ новых пользователей
Почта с временных сервисов, типа mailinator.com, gawab.com и/или прочих, которые предоставляют временный почтовый ящик без регистрации и/или почтовый ящик для рассылки спама, отслеживается и блокируется, а так же заносится в спам-блок форума, аккаунты удаляются
Если вы хотите приобрести какой то скрипт/продукт/хак из каталогов перечисленных ниже: Каталог модулей/хаков
Ещё раз обращаем Ваше внимание: всё, что Вы скачиваете и устанавливаете на свой форум, Вы устанавливаете исключительно на свой страх и риск.
Сообщество vBSupport'а физически не в состоянии проверять все стили, хаки и нули, выкладываемые пользователями.
Помните: безопасность Вашего проекта - Ваша забота. Убедительная просьба: при обнаружении уязвимостей или сомнительных кодов обязательно отписывайтесь в теме хака/стиля
Спасибо за понимание
Здраствуйте. У меня такая проблема.
На форуме установлен vBadvanced. Требуется обновить форум с 3.7.4 до 3.8.1 и vBadvanced c 3.0.1 до 3.1.
Сначала сделал бекап базы и всех файлов. Потом залил с на фтп с перезаписью новые файлы cmps, обновил. Все работает. Потом залил файлы форума. Процесс обновления работал нормально, но если после него попробовать зайти на сайт или форум - на верху каждой страницы будет написано
Code:
Warning: array_keys() [function.array-keys]: The first argument should be an array in [path]/includes/functions.php on line 4227
Warning: Invalid argument supplied for foreach() in [path]/includes/functions.php on line 4227
Warning: Invalid argument supplied for foreach() in [path]/includes/vba_cmps_include_bottom.php on line 219
А ниже сообщение о том что я забанен навсегда (куда бы не зашел).
Если попробовать зайти в админку - вижу сообщение
Code:
"Не удается отправить cookies. Header уже отправлен".
Погуглил все эти ошибки - везде советуют с помощью файла tools.php перестроить кэш. Мне это абсолютно не помогает.
Буду очень признателен за помощь, форум уже неделю висит.
чей "нулл"?
почему именно 3.8.1, а не 3.8.2?
что в строках с 4220 по 4230 файла functions.php ?
пробовал ли отключать все хаки в конфиге?
почему сначала обновил портал, а не наоборот?
@Uber Team
Простоузер
Join Date: Jun 2008
Posts: 12
Reputation:
Novice 1
Репутация в разделе: 0
0
Quote:
Originally Posted by kerk
чей "нулл"?
FintMax
Quote:
Originally Posted by kerk
почему именно 3.8.1, а не 3.8.2?
Когда пытаюсь обновиться до 3.8.2 файл upgrade.php выдает ошибку
Code:
Vbulletin 3.8 requires MySQL version 4.0.16 or greater. Your MySQL is version MYSQL_VERSION, please ask your host to upgrade.
хотя на сервере стоит 5.0.70-r1. С админом сервера так и не могли решить эту проблему, решил остановиться на 3.8.1 потому что там эта ошибка не возникает.
Quote:
Originally Posted by kerk
что в строках с 4220 по 4230 файла functions.php ?
Code:
}
if (!is_array($user['forumpermissions']))
{
$user['forumpermissions'] = array();
}
foreach (array_keys($vbulletin->forumcache) AS $forumid)
{
if (!isset($user['forumpermissions']["$forumid"]))
{
Quote:
Originally Posted by kerk
пробовал ли отключать все хаки в конфиге?
нет, потому что насколько я знаю vBadvanced фактически является для vB хаком. Если бы я отключил хаки, то vBadvanced перестала бы работать.
Quote:
Originally Posted by kerk
почему сначала обновил портал, а не наоборот?
Пробовал и так и так. Результат одинаковый.
kerk
k0t
Join Date: May 2005
Location: localhost
Posts: 28,712
Версия vB: 3.8.x
Пол:
Reputation:
Гуру 20257
Репутация в разделе: 3212
0
оптимизируй таблицы БД (в админке/обслуживание)
отключи все хаки в файле конфига, удали русский язык от старой версии форума, потом обнови форум до последней версии
@Uber Team
Простоузер
Join Date: Jun 2008
Posts: 12
Reputation:
Novice 1
Репутация в разделе: 0
0
kerk
не помогло
@RazdoR
Простоузер
Join Date: Aug 2008
Posts: 34
Версия vB: 3.8.2
Reputation:
Lamer -5
Репутация в разделе: 0
0
А что мешает перезалить движок булки и обновиться еще раз? А потом обновить vBadvanced
@Uber Team
Простоузер
Join Date: Jun 2008
Posts: 12
Reputation:
Novice 1
Репутация в разделе: 0
0
RazdoR
не понял что ты хочешь сказать
@RazdoR
Простоузер
Join Date: Aug 2008
Posts: 34
Версия vB: 3.8.2
Reputation:
Lamer -5
Репутация в разделе: 0
0
Ну что ты хочешь сделать? Обновить vBulletin с 3.7.4 до 3.8.1 и обновить и vBadvanced c 3.0.1 до 3.1. Уже обновив - имеешь проблемы, но у тебя есть бэкап файлов и бд. Удаляешь с фостинга глючный обновленный двиг, заливаешь старый рабочий бэкап, проверяешь работоспособность. Далее обновляешь vBulletin до нужной версии, а затем vBadvanced